Class TextOutput

TextOutput

ออบเจ็กต์ TextExport ที่สามารถแสดงจากสคริปต์

เนื่องจากข้อควรพิจารณาด้านความปลอดภัย สคริปต์จะส่งเนื้อหาข้อความไปยังเบราว์เซอร์โดยตรงไม่ได้ แต่ระบบจะเปลี่ยนเส้นทางเบราว์เซอร์ไปยัง googleusercontent.com แทน ซึ่งจะแสดงข้อมูลโดยไม่มีการทำความสะอาดหรือปรับเปลี่ยนใดๆ เพิ่มเติม

คุณสามารถแสดงเนื้อหาข้อความในลักษณะต่อไปนี้

function doGet() {
  return ContentService.createTextOutput("hello world!");
}
นอกจากนี้ยังมีเมธอดในการแสดงผล JSON, RSS และ XML เป็น TextExport โปรดดูเมธอดที่เกี่ยวข้องใน ContentService

วิธีการ

วิธีการประเภทการแสดงผลรายละเอียดแบบย่อ
append(addedContent)TextOutputเพิ่มเนื้อหาใหม่ต่อท้ายเนื้อหาที่จะแสดง
clear()TextOutputล้างเนื้อหาปัจจุบัน
downloadAsFile(filename)TextOutputบอกเบราว์เซอร์ให้ดาวน์โหลดแทนการแสดงเนื้อหานี้
getContent()Stringรับเนื้อหาที่จะแสดง
getFileName()Stringแสดงผลชื่อไฟล์เพื่อดาวน์โหลดไฟล์นี้ หรือค่า Null หากควรแสดงมากกว่าดาวน์โหลด
getMimeType()MimeTypeรับข้อมูลประเภท MIME ที่จะให้เนื้อหาปรากฏ
setContent(content)TextOutputตั้งค่าเนื้อหาที่จะแสดง
setMimeType(mimeType)TextOutputตั้งค่าประเภท MIME สำหรับเนื้อหาที่จะแสดง

เอกสารประกอบโดยละเอียด

append(addedContent)

เพิ่มเนื้อหาใหม่ต่อท้ายเนื้อหาที่จะแสดง

พารามิเตอร์

ชื่อTypeคำอธิบาย
addedContentStringเนื้อหาที่จะต่อท้าย

รีเทิร์น

TextOutput — TextExport นี้เอง ซึ่งมีประโยชน์สำหรับการทำเชน


clear()

ล้างเนื้อหาปัจจุบัน

รีเทิร์น

TextOutput — TextExport นี้เอง ซึ่งมีประโยชน์สำหรับการทำเชน


downloadAsFile(filename)

บอกเบราว์เซอร์ให้ดาวน์โหลดแทนการแสดงเนื้อหานี้

บางเบราว์เซอร์จะไม่สนใจการตั้งค่านี้ การตั้งค่านี้เป็น Null จะล้างการตั้งค่ากลับไปเป็นลักษณะเริ่มต้นของการแสดงแทนการดาวน์โหลด

พารามิเตอร์

ชื่อTypeคำอธิบาย
filenameStringเพื่อบอกให้เบราว์เซอร์ใช้

รีเทิร์น

TextOutput — ออบเจ็กต์ TextExport มีประโยชน์สำหรับการทำเชน

การขว้าง

Error — หากชื่อไฟล์มีอักขระที่ไม่ถูกต้อง


getContent()

รับเนื้อหาที่จะแสดง

รีเทิร์น

String — เนื้อหาที่จะแสดง


getFileName()

แสดงผลชื่อไฟล์เพื่อดาวน์โหลดไฟล์นี้ หรือค่า Null หากควรแสดงมากกว่าดาวน์โหลด

รีเทิร์น

String — ชื่อไฟล์


getMimeType()

รับข้อมูลประเภท MIME ที่จะให้เนื้อหาปรากฏ

รีเทิร์น

MimeType — ประเภท MIME ที่จะแสดงพร้อมกับ


setContent(content)

ตั้งค่าเนื้อหาที่จะแสดง

พารามิเตอร์

ชื่อTypeคำอธิบาย
contentStringเนื้อหาที่จะแสดง

รีเทิร์น

TextOutput — TextExport นี้เอง ซึ่งมีประโยชน์สำหรับการทำเชน


setMimeType(mimeType)

ตั้งค่าประเภท MIME สำหรับเนื้อหาที่จะแสดง ค่าเริ่มต้นคือข้อความธรรมดา

พารามิเตอร์

ชื่อTypeคำอธิบาย
mimeTypeMimeTypeประเภท MIME

รีเทิร์น

TextOutput — TextExport นี้เอง ซึ่งมีประโยชน์สำหรับการทำเชน